I can't believe cinnamon worked! by destroymode96 in lifehacks

[–]Jmarsh99 15 points16 points  (0 children)

Just an FYI. DE doesn’t draw out fluids, the particulates are fine enough that they get stuck in the exoskeleton of the insect and prevents it from retaining moisture.

Insects have a “waxy” coating outer layer that prevents water loss as well as many holes that they breathe through called Spiracles.
